3. Your Pet Will Discover Social Abilities
Typically, dogs who invest too much time in the house alone can develop splitting up anxiety or act strongly towards other pet dogs. Regular pet dog childcare allows your dog to interact with various other pets in a safe setting, which helps them learn exactly how to behave properly around various other animals and people.

Throughout play sessions, employee check interactions and step in when essential to prevent excessively harsh actions. They likewise show dogs exactly how to check out various other canines' social signs, such as sniffing, tail wagging and roaring. This training equates to various other aspects of your pet dog's life, helping them be much less fearful or reactive in brand-new scenarios outside of the day care setup.

Be sure to ask the facility's administration concerning their approach to canine socializing and just how they manage disputes. Stay clear of facilities that utilize aversive training strategies, as these can create behavior concerns down the line.

4. Your Dog Will Get Interest
Pets that are left home alone all day frequently come to be bored and turn to devastating behavior, such as chewing. Canine childcare gives your dog with the attention they need to keep them delighted and healthy and balanced.

Ask the childcare facility about their playgroups and exactly how they are staffed. Preferably, the childcare staff will have a number of individuals supervising each group to guarantee that nobody is obtaining injured. Ask about their conflict resolution techniques, particularly just how they take care of play that becomes as well harsh.

Some pet dogs take a little time to get used to remaining in a large group of canines, however the majority of will certainly get over their initial worry with routine presence. Pay close attention to your dog's habits when they return from day care, and you'll be able to tell whether they enjoyed their time there. Normally, pet dogs that return fired up and energised are having a blast. You'll also receive daily feedback from the day care personnel on just how your pet has actually been doing.
